Abstract
A comprehensive survey of the literature on the hairiness of yarns is presented. The techniques used in the measurement of hairiness are classified and discussed in detail. The parameters used to express hairiness and to derive the theory of hairiness are considered. The effects on hairiness are discussed of fibre and yarn characteristics, different spinning processes, and processes subsequent to spinning (winding, singeing, bleaching, dyeing, and sizing).
